Officials Consult on Bird Flu Preparations

LOS ANGELES, CA
MARKET WIRE
10/19/2005

WHAT:

Media briefing on efforts by federal, state, local and airport officials in planning emergency response to passengers presenting signs and symptoms of a possible communicable disease at Los Angeles International Airport (LAX). The media briefing will follow a 5-1/2 hour, closed-door table-top exercise and planning meeting attended by airport, healthcare, public health and other stakeholders to discuss the multi-agency response.

Thursday, Oct. 20: Centers for Disease Control, local health officials and LAWA representatives will hold a media availability following a 5-1/2 hour tabletop exercise on preparations to protect Southern California from a potential pandemic. LAX is considered the key entry point for possible transmission of bird flu into the U.S. because it is the number one air gateway from Asia. LAWA expects to complete preparations and response plan in November. (approx. 2 p.m. Radisson Hotel near LAX).
